This is an interesting chicken breast entree ... the balsamic vinegar caramelizes nicely with the brown sugar and shallots. I was following a basic recipe and then started adding things to turn it into something completely different! Serve with mashed potatoes, definitely!
Provided by EdsGirlAngie
Categories Chicken Breast
Time 1h20m
Yield 2 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Melt butter with 1 teaspoon of the Liquid Smoke.
- Saute shallots until golden, then add garlic.
- Season chicken with salt and pepper to taste, then brown chicken about 10 minutes, turning once.
- Add garlic and one cup of water to skillet and boil, stirring, one minute.
- Return chicken to skillet and arrange skin sides up.
- Gently simmer, covered, until chicken is cooked through and garlic is tender, about 35 minutes.
- Remove chicken from skillet; add balsamic vinegar, brown sugar and remaining one teaspoon of Liquid Smoke.
- Boil, uncovered, until slightly thickened.
- Return chicken to pan and allow sauce to vinegar-sugar mixture to caramelize a bit on the chicken, about 10 more minutes.
- Season to tast with salt and pepper and serve!
